The Role of Radiator Valves in Cooling Towers

1. Understanding Cooling Towers and Their Function

Cooling towers are essential components in industrial processes and HVAC systems, designed to remove excess heat from water used in cooling applications. They work by allowing water to evaporate, which cools the remaining liquid, thus providing a continuous supply of cooled water to various systems. Within this context, radiator valves play a critical role in regulating water flow, ensuring that the cooling process operates efficiently. By managing the flow of water to and from the cooling tower, these valves help maintain optimal performance and temperature levels, directly impacting the overall effectiveness of the cooling system.

2. Flow Control and Temperature Regulation

Radiator valves are vital for controlling the flow of water in cooling towers, significantly influencing the temperature regulation process. By adjusting the water flow rate, these valves help maintain the desired temperature within the cooling system. For instance, when water enters the cooling tower at a higher temperature, the radiator valves can be adjusted to increase the flow, facilitating more effective heat exchange. Conversely, if the water temperature is low, the valves can reduce the flow rate, ensuring that the system does not over-cool. This precise control allows for better thermal efficiency and ensures that the cooling tower operates within its optimal temperature range, preventing potential system failures.

3. Enhancing System Efficiency

The integration of radiator valves in cooling towers contributes significantly to the overall efficiency of the cooling system. By optimizing water flow, these valves minimize energy consumption, reduce wear and tear on pumps, and lower operational costs. Efficient flow management also helps prevent issues like water stagnation, which can lead to microbial growth and reduced system performance. Additionally, well-maintained radiator valves ensure that the cooling tower operates at peak efficiency, maximizing its cooling capacity while minimizing the environmental impact. By focusing on efficiency, organizations can achieve substantial savings in energy costs and improve the sustainability of their cooling operations.

4. Preventing System Imbalances

Imbalances in the cooling system can lead to inefficiencies and operational challenges, making the role of radiator valves even more crucial. If certain areas receive too much or too little cooling, it can cause uneven temperature distribution, resulting in equipment stress and potential damage. Radiator valves help mitigate these issues by allowing for fine-tuning of water flow to different parts of the system. By adjusting the valves accordingly, operators can ensure that all components receive the appropriate cooling, maintaining system balance and prolonging the lifespan of the equipment. This capability is especially important in large facilities with complex cooling needs.

5. Maintenance and Monitoring Considerations

Regular maintenance and monitoring of radiator valves in cooling towers are essential for ensuring their reliable operation. Over time, valves may suffer from wear, corrosion, or blockages that can hinder performance. Implementing a routine maintenance schedule that includes inspections, cleaning, and timely repairs can help prevent these issues and keep the cooling system running efficiently. Additionally, utilizing smart monitoring technologies can provide real-time data on valve performance and system conditions, allowing for proactive adjustments. By prioritizing maintenance and monitoring, organizations can enhance the longevity and efficiency of their cooling towers, ensuring consistent cooling performance and reducing overall operational costs.
